Output 37500078323f1ef4b3dd906746a4f9858147eacc60e70236628840b7b5a61fe8:5

value
600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e91648cbfdaa56b4df2b51639bf87dcadbf43b OP_EQUAL
address
32W8ZFUi853xTXP3TQPRS91bogCpfKf4du
transaction
37500078323f1ef4b3dd906746a4f9858147eacc60e70236628840b7b5a61fe8
spent
false

1 Sat Range